How Ibuprofen Works to Reduce Pain and Fever

 

Ibuprofen belongs to a group of medicines called non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s). It works by blocking the production of certain chemicals in the body called prostaglandins, which are responsible for causing pain, inflammation, and fever. By reducing prostaglandin production, ibuprofen effectively lowers body temperature during fever episodes and provides relief from various types of pain.

The liquid formulation allows for faster absorption compared to solid forms, typically beginning to work within 15-30 minutes of administration. This makes it particularly suitable for managing acute symptoms in children who need prompt relief.

 

Suitable for Children Aged 3 Months and Over

 

This nurofen children liquid is specifically formulated for paediatric use and is suitable for children from 3 months of age, provided they weigh at least 5kg. It offers versatile symptom management for various childhood conditions and can be particularly helpful when other pain relief options are not suitable.

The medicine is appropriate for treating several common childhood symptoms:

  • Fever reduction during illness
  • Relief from headaches and general aches
  • Management of toothache and teething discomfort
  • Earache and throat pain relief

 

Sugar-Free Formulation for Better Oral Health

 

This liquid ibuprofen strawberry formulation is sugar-free, making it a more suitable choice for children's dental health. Regular exposure to sugar-containing medicines can contribute to tooth decay, particularly when administered frequently during illness periods. The sugar-free formulation helps minimise this risk while still providing the appealing taste that encourages children to take their medicine.

The absence of sugar also makes this medicine more suitable for children with diabetes or those following sugar-restricted diets, though medical supervision is still required for these patient groups.
